1. New Lowndes Middle School Campus Development
What Lowndes Middle School Is Doing
Lowndes Middle School, under the Lowndes County School District, is actively engaged in the design and planning phase for a new middle school campus. This multi-phase project involves developing a 150,000-square-foot facility including administrative offices, a media center, modern classrooms, and a gymnasium. The design work is scheduled for completion by March 2026, with construction anticipated to begin in June 2026.

3. Digital Learning Platform Integration and Security
What Lowndes Middle School Is Doing
Lowndes Middle School leverages a comprehensive suite of digital learning platforms, including PowerSchool, Schoology, and Google Classroom, to support instruction and student engagement. The district actively implements Go-Guardian for monitoring G-Suite, Chromebook, and active directory student accounts, and utilizes iBoss for internet filtering across all technology resources. These systems collectively create a managed and secure digital learning environment.
